Fuel Ethanol


Ethanol (anhydrous grade) has been used since early 1950 as a gasoline additive for its attractive properties. This product is mainly blend in a range varying from 5% up to 25% into gasoline and/or used in the synthesis of ETBE of the new development oxygenate ethers.

Ethanol (hydrous Grade) is mostly used as a neat fuel ethanol for alcohol and flex fuel vehicles.
